How to Find Lost Car Keys

The loss of your car keys could happen at the most awkward times. It can be a hassle when you are trying to leave the house or are returning home after an extended workday.

chrome_trhg3QMQrz.pngTrack your steps and verify each place you might have left them. You can use a Bluetooth tracker to locate your keys.

Make sure you have your bags and pockets checked.

It's not uncommon to be unable to find things between getting your kids to school, work shopping for groceries and preparing dinner for you and your spouse, and the countless other tasks that you have to complete. This is especially true of keys to cars. Losing your keys can throw an enormous wrench into your plans and even result in you missing out on something that you wanted to do. It doesn't mean that you should quit or panic. You can easily recover your keys by following a few simple steps.

The first place you should look for your keys is in the place where you think you may have lost keys. It's usually the last place you'll can remember having them, and it's also one of the most frequent places people lose them. Check every pocket of your clothes and bags. If you're carrying bags or backpacks take a look at every compartment and pocket, including the zippered areas. You may need empty your bag completely to find your keys if missing however it's worth a thorough search just in case.

If you still cannot find your keys, then it is time to contact the experts. Depending on the type of key you have you'll either need to call a locksmith to make a new key for you or you will have to travel to the dealer. In any case, it's best to get a spare key made to ensure you don't get into the same situation in the future.

In the future, try to keep your keys in a particular place once you arrive home. This will help you to locate your keys whenever you need to. It is possible to do this by putting them in the same spot each day, whether that's on a hook or a bowl at your entry table. You may want to consider investing in a Bluetooth tracker, which can be linked to your phone and used to locate your keys if they are lost.

Examine the inside of your Car

It's easy to get lost keys To car in the chaos of school drop-off and pickup shopping trips, and dinner with friends. It could be an item in your wallet, a pair sunglasses or even keys. Regardless of what gets lost, it's important to remain calm and follow some simple steps that will aid you in finding your missing keys.

Begin by retracing the steps and then checking all the places you've been recently. If you're certain you've put your keys in the car, make sure you check the doors and the trunk. Be sure to check under the seats and in the cupholders. Be sure to look for the "black holes" in every car. This is the space that lies between the center console and the driver's or passenger' seat. It's a small space but it's large enough to eat the keys to your car and hide them away.

If you're still struggling to locate your car keys, then it's time to make calls. The first step is to contact your insurance company and inform them of the issue. If you are not quick it is possible for someone to take your keys and take your vehicle.

Contacting a locksmith is the next step. If you have a standard key, they'll be able to replace a lost car key it for you. If you have a smart key, you will need to visit the car dealership. The dealership will be able to pair the new key to your car.

It's always an excellent idea to have a spare car key created. This way, you won't be worried about losing your primary car key. Just make sure to keep it away from your usual keychain such as in the drawer in your kitchen or with a family member. You can also save money by having a spare key in case your current key needs to be replaced. It's cheaper than purchasing an entirely new car.
